# Trigger the maui-copilot DevDiv pipeline when a maintainer comments '/review' on a PR.
# Uses OIDC (no PAT) — see .github/docs/trigger-azdo-pipeline-setup.md for identity setup.
name: Review Trigger
on:
issue_comment:
types: [created]
workflow_dispatch:
inputs:
pr_number:
description: 'PR number to review'
required: true
platform:
description: 'Target platform (android, ios, catalyst, windows, or empty for pipeline default)'
required: false
type: choice
options:
- ''
- android
- ios
- catalyst
- windows
pipeline_ref:
description: 'AzDO pipeline branch (default: main)'
required: false
default: 'main'
jobs:
# Lightweight pre-flight gate that matches the command and checks permission
# before provisioning the write-capable trigger-review job.
match:
if: github.event_name == 'workflow_dispatch' || github.event.issue.pull_request
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
timeout-minutes: 2
permissions:
contents: read
pull-requests: read
outputs:
matched: ${{ steps.check.outputs.matched }}
proceed: ${{ steps.gate.outputs.proceed }}
steps:
- name: Match /review command
id: check
env:
COMMENT_BODY: ${{ github.event.comment.body }}
EVENT_NAME: ${{ github.event_name }}
run: |
if [ "${EVENT_NAME}" = "workflow_dispatch" ]; then
echo "matched=true"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
exit 0
fi
TRIMMED_BODY=$(printf '%s' "${COMMENT_BODY}" | sed -e 's/^[[:space:]]*//' -e 's/[[:space:]]*$//')
# `/review rerun` is not a supported command. Reject it explicitly so
# it cannot fall through to the generic `/review` matcher below. `sed`
# strips leading whitespace per line, so a leading BLANK line survives in
# TRIMMED_BODY; tolerate leading whitespace/newlines here (consistent with
# the generic matcher) so a pasted `\n/review rerun` can't evade the guard.
if [[ "${TRIMMED_BODY}" =~ ^[[:space:]]*/review[[:space:]]+rerun([[:space:]]|$) ]]; then
echo "matched=false"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
exit 0
fi
# Match `/review` as the first non-whitespace token, optionally followed by args.
# Allows arbitrary leading whitespace (spaces, tabs, newlines).
# `/review tests` is reserved for the gh-aw test-failure review workflow.
if [[ "${COMMENT_BODY}" =~ ^[[:space:]]*/review[[:space:]]+tests([[:space:]]|$) ]]; then
echo "matched=false"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
elif [[ "${COMMENT_BODY}" =~ ^[[:space:]]*/review([[:space:]]|$) ]]; then
echo "matched=true"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
else
echo "matched=false"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
fi
- name: Check actor permission
id: gate
if: steps.check.outputs.matched == 'true'
env:
GH_TOKEN: ${{ github.token }}
ACTOR: ${{ github.actor }}
REPO: ${{ github.repository }}
EVENT_NAME: ${{ github.event_name }}
run: |
if [ "${EVENT_NAME}" = "workflow_dispatch" ]; then
echo "workflow_dispatch — skipping collaborator check"
echo "proceed=true"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
exit 0
fi
if ! PERMISSION=$(gh api "repos/${REPO}/collaborators/${ACTOR}/permission" --jq '.permission' 2>/dev/null); then
echo "::warning::Permission lookup failed for ${ACTOR}; treating the caller as unauthorized."
PERMISSION="none"
fi
echo "User ${ACTOR} has permission: ${PERMISSION}"
# write, maintain, and admin can all trigger /review
if [[ "${PERMISSION}" != "admin" && "${PERMISSION}" != "maintain" && "${PERMISSION}" != "write" ]]; then
echo "::notice::User ${ACTOR} does not have sufficient access (${PERMISSION}). Only write/maintain/admin can trigger /review. Skipping."
echo "proceed=false"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
exit 0
fi
echo "proceed=true"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"

# OIDC -> AzDO token exchange -> pipeline trigger combined into a single
# step. Keeping the tokens in shell-local variables avoids persisting them
# through `$GITHUB_OUTPUT` between steps (where they are masked but still
# serialized to disk on the runner).
- name: Trigger maui-copilot pipeline
id: trigger_azdo
if: steps.review_lock.outputs.locked != 'true'
env:
PR_NUMBER: ${{ steps.params.outputs.pr_number }}
PIPELINE_REF: ${{ steps.params.outputs.pipeline_ref }}
PLATFORM: ${{ steps.infer.outputs.platform }}
AZDO_TENANT_ID: ${{ secrets.AZDO_TRIGGER_TENANT_ID }}
AZDO_CLIENT_ID: ${{ secrets.AZDO_TRIGGER_CLIENT_ID }}
run: |
# 1. Get GitHub OIDC token
OIDC_TOKEN=$(curl -s -H "Authorization: bearer ${ACTIONS_ID_TOKEN_REQUEST_TOKEN}" \
"${ACTIONS_ID_TOKEN_REQUEST_URL}&audience=api://AzureADTokenExchange" \
| jq -r '.value')
if [ -z "$OIDC_TOKEN" ] || [ "$OIDC_TOKEN" = "null" ]; then
echo "::error::Failed to get OIDC token"
exit 1
fi
echo "::add-mask::${OIDC_TOKEN}"
# 2. Exchange OIDC token for AzDO access token
AZURE_RESPONSE=$(curl -s -X POST \
"https://login.microsoftonline.com/${AZDO_TENANT_ID}/oauth2/v2.0/token" \
-d "grant_type=client_credentials" \
-d "client_id=${AZDO_CLIENT_ID}" \
-d "client_assertion_type=urn:ietf:params:oauth:client-assertion-type:jwt-bearer" \
-d "client_assertion=${OIDC_TOKEN}" \
-d "scope=499b84ac-1321-427f-aa17-267ca6975798/.default")
# Drop OIDC token from memory once we have the AzDO token
unset OIDC_TOKEN
AZDO_TOKEN=$(echo "$AZURE_RESPONSE" | jq -r '.access_token')
if [ -z "$AZDO_TOKEN" ] || [ "$AZDO_TOKEN" = "null" ]; then
echo "::error::Failed to get Azure AD token"
echo "$AZURE_RESPONSE" | jq '{error, error_description, error_codes, timestamp, trace_id}' 2>/dev/null \
|| echo "(failed to parse AAD response — check job permissions)"
exit 1
fi
echo "::add-mask::${AZDO_TOKEN}"
unset AZURE_RESPONSE
# 3. Trigger the pipeline
echo "Triggering maui-copilot pipeline for PR #${PR_NUMBER} (platform: ${PLATFORM}, ref: ${PIPELINE_REF})..."
# Platform is always resolved at this point (inferred or explicit).
# Build JSON payload safely with jq to avoid injection.
PAYLOAD=$(jq -n \
--arg pr "${PR_NUMBER}" \
--arg plat "${PLATFORM}" \
--arg ref "refs/heads/${PIPELINE_REF}" \
'{
templateParameters: { PRNumber: $pr, Platform: $plat },
resources: { repositories: { self: { refName: $ref } } }
}')
RESPONSE=$(curl -s -w "\n%{http_code}" \
-X POST "https://dev.azure.com/DevDiv/DevDiv/_apis/pipelines/27723/runs?api-version=7.1" \
-H "Authorization: Bearer ${AZDO_TOKEN}"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d "${PAYLOAD}")
unset AZDO_TOKEN
HTTP_CODE=$(echo "${RESPONSE}" | tail -1)
RESPONSE_BODY=$(echo "${RESPONSE}" | head -n -1)
echo "HTTP Status: ${HTTP_CODE}"
if [ "${HTTP_CODE}" -ge 200 ] && [ "${HTTP_CODE}" -lt 300 ]; then
RUN_ID=$(echo "${RESPONSE_BODY}" | jq -r '.id')
PIPELINE_NAME=$(echo "${RESPONSE_BODY}" | jq -r '.pipeline.name')
echo "Pipeline '${PIPELINE_NAME}' triggered! Run ID: ${RUN_ID}"
echo "View: https://devdiv.visualstudio.com/DevDiv/_build/results?buildId=${RUN_ID}"
else
echo "::error::Failed to trigger pipeline. HTTP ${HTTP_CODE}"
echo "${RESPONSE_BODY}" | jq . 2>/dev/null || echo "${RESPONSE_BODY}"
exit 1
fi
